Henry SpringeHello, I'm Henry Springe, founder and owner of Henry Contracting. I was born right here in Leavenworth, as was my Dad, a tax attorney, my Grand Dad & my Great-Grand Dad who owned the uniform and tailoring business in town! My grandmother on my father's side, the Stoltz's, were also from here. They owned Stoltz's Wholesale Grocery which was located in downtown Leavenworth. I have a younger brother David, also an attorney, who is the President for the Kansas Corporation Commission.

I started my company in 2000 but have been in this line of work for over 25 years. In 1980, after attending Leavenworth High School, I worked for a company in Oklahoma for a couple years running pipelines from oil rigs to oil storage areas. In 1983, the work dried-up so I came back to Leavenworth and started pouring concrete for Leavcon, a commercial and residential contracting company here in town. In 1989, I left Leavcon and attended DeVry University majoring in check printer repair and maintenance. After graduating at the top of my class, I went to work for a company named Check Technology maintaining their printers. I did this for about ten years. Since much of the work was on-call, I had time to moonlight between calls and on weekends so I got back to doing some concrete flatwork. During the 90's, I built-up my equipment inventory for this type of work, first a Bobcat, then a Kubota tractor, and finally some dump trucks. In 2000, my wife Renae suggested that I do contracting full-time. So, I jumped right in, put my name on the side of my truck and did what I do best. Through word of mouth and a reputation of quality work, my business has grown into a successful company, keeping me busy throughout the year!
